Checkers Drive In Restaurant in Jacksonville has accumulated 101 violations across 20 inspections since 2016, averaging 5.05 violations per inspection — at the statewide benchmark. The facility has not experienced an emergency closure. High-priority violations have appeared consistently across the record, with employee health reporting violations cited in at least 5 inspections, food contact surface violations in 6 inspections, and chemical storage violations in 5 inspections. The most recent inspection on November 3, 2025 documented 10 violations including high-priority findings for employee health reporting, chemical storage, and food contact surfaces, with the inspection completed and no further action required.
